Understanding the Importance of TOEFL Listening Practice Conversation
The T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language) exam is a standardized test designed to evaluate non-native English speakers’ proficiency, particularly in academic contexts. Among its four sections—Reading, Listening, Speaking, and Writing—the Listening section is crucial because it assesses your ability to understand spoken English in various settings, such as classrooms, conversations, and lectures.
What Does the TOEFL Listening Section Entail?
The listening section typically consists of:
- Conversations: Short discussions between two speakers, often involving social or academic topics.
- Lectures: Longer monologues on academic subjects.
The TOEFL listening practice conversation focuses on the first type—interactive dialogues that test your ability to comprehend everyday speech patterns, idiomatic expressions, and the speaker’s intent.
Why Are Listening Conversations Critical for TOEFL Success?
Conversations in the TOEFL listening section simulate real-life communication, requiring test-takers to:
- Identify key details and main ideas.
- Understand implied meanings and speaker attitudes.
- Recognize transitions and discourse markers.
- Distinguish between factual information and opinions.
Mastering these skills through targeted TOEFL listening practice conversation enhances overall listening comprehension, which is essential not only for the exam but also for academic and social interactions in English-speaking environments.

Effective Strategies for TOEFL Listening Practice Conversation
To maximize the benefits of TOEFL listening practice conversations, whether through Talkpal or other resources, consider incorporating the following strategies into your study routine.
1. Active Listening and Note-Taking
During practice sessions, actively focus on the content by:
- Listening for main ideas and supporting details.
- Jotting down keywords, phrases, and speaker attitudes.
- Noting any unknown vocabulary to review later.
Active engagement improves concentration and retention, which are vital for the TOEFL listening section.
2. Repeated Exposure and Shadowing
Listen to the same conversation multiple times to:
- Catch details missed during the first listen.
- Understand pronunciation, intonation, and rhythm.
- Practice shadowing—repeating immediately after the speaker—to enhance listening and speaking skills simultaneously.
3. Focus on Discourse Markers and Transition Words
Recognize words and phrases like “however,” “on the other hand,” “in addition,” and “as a result” to:
- Understand the relationship between ideas.
- Follow the speaker’s argument or explanation more easily.
This skill is often tested in TOEFL listening conversations.
4. Practice with Diverse Accents and Speaking Speeds

5. Take Practice Tests Under Timed Conditions
Simulate the test environment by:
- Listening to conversations and answering questions within set time limits.
- Developing time management skills.
- Building test-taking confidence.
